Dear all,

 

Trusted Membership gives you access to the more private part of the forum, where, among others, you will find an area to have a go at validation or revalidation of supercentenarians. In order to be eligible for trusted membership, you will have to meet the following criteria:

 

1. You will need to have been a member of this forum for at least three (3) months.

2. You will need to have made a minimum of fifty (50) posts. [Meaning... if you haven't made fifty posts in the first three months, you won't be a TM yet.]

3. You will need to have made at least one hundred (100) posts in the previous year to remain trusted member. [Applicable as of 1 March 2023]

4. You will need to have a clean track record: no bans or suspensions, and/or improved behaviour after a warning.

5. You will need to have made quality posts, i.e. more than "happy birthday!" or "RIP".

6. Trusted Membership is given at the discretion of the admin + moderators. We will need to feel you can be trusted.

 

I realise that especially points 5+6 are subjective and could cause frustration or irritation. And that is perfectly okay. If you feel that you should be given trusted membership but you have not been awarded it (yet), please feel free to discuss it in the "Complaints Corner" subforum. That's what it exists for.

 

As for these first three months, points 1+2 are an issue as well, as some members have immediately gained TM status, whereas others have not yet. This is also to do with what we know of the current members and their backgrounds - with some, it helps they've shown good behaviour elsewhere, with others it might be the case we just don't know them well enough yet. In any case, please realise that in these first couple of months (let's say until the end of June) you might see members being granted trusted membership, even if they might not meet criterion 1 or 2 yet. Once more, feel free to address this perceived unfairness in the "Complaints Corner" subforum.

 

And please realise this first and foremost: the admin and the moderators are human beings. We make mistakes, too, and we will probably (unknowingly) be biased in some cases. But we are always willing to discuss why we have taken certain decisions - and this might even lead to decisions being revisited (as has already happened).
